Question:

Assume that the population of heights of men has a normal distribution with a mean of 69.5 in. and random samples of 100 men result in sample mean heights with a mean of 69.5 in. and a standard deviation of 0.24 in.
a. If one sample of 100 men results in a mean height of 69.0 in., how many standard deviations is the sample mean from the population mean?
b. What is the probability that a second sample of 100 men would have a mean less than 69.0 in.?
